Scale Image

This application is based on PlayFramework and uses a Srcimage library to modify images.

Project includes following:

  • Ability to upload multiple files from UI
  • Ability to upload multiple files from API request.
  • Ability to accept multipart/form-data requests.
  • Ability to accept JSON requests with BASE64 encoded images.
  • Ability to upload images at a given URL (image posted somewhere on the Internet).
  • Create a square preview of the image for a given width and height (default size 100px by 100px).
  • Tests (Unit, Browser, Functional and Integration).
  • Docker integration

Running The Application

From The Terminal

To run the application please invoke the following command:

sbt run

This will start the server in dev mode listening on port 9000.

Docker

To run in production mode inside a Docker container simply run command below:

docker-compose up

You can access to web UI via url:

http://localhost:9000

API documentation

POST /api/file-upload?width=100&height=100

localhost:9000/api/file-upload?width=100&height=100

Accepts multipart/form-data requests with multiple files and returns image urls as JSON


POST /api/data-upload?width=100&height=100

localhost:9000/api/data-upload?width=100&height=100

Accepts application/json requests with Dase64 encoded file bytes and returns image urls as JSON

Data Example:

{
  "file": [
    { "content": "iVBORw0KGgoAAAANSUhEUgAAAMoAAACyCAYAAAADFFAEAAAABHNCSVQICAgIfAhkiAAAABl0RVh0" },
    { "content": "iVBORw0KGgoAAAANSUhEUgAAAMoAAACyCAYAAAADFFAEAAAABHNCSVQICAgIfAhkiAAAABl0RVh0" },
  ]
}

POST /api/from-url?url=image_url&width=100&height=100

localhost:9000/api/from-url?url=image_url&width=100&height=100

Accepts image url as query parameter and returns image url as JSON
